One of our top priorities is to create a more productive environment for Mamaroneck’s volunteer committees. These committees let residents with varied backgrounds and experiences offer invaluable advice to the Village administration and elected officials. We’re looking to fill vacancies with the most qualified candidates in the Village, and would like you to consider whether you, or anyone you know, could effectively fill the openings on the current committees.
